Warning as toxic cloud released | Warning as toxic cloud released |
(10 minutes later) | |
A toxic cloud caused by a fire at a chemical plant is spreading across parts of the West Midlands. | A toxic cloud caused by a fire at a chemical plant is spreading across parts of the West Midlands. |
Police said the cloud of phosphorous measuring about 50ft by 400ft was being blown south towards the M5. | Police said the cloud of phosphorous measuring about 50ft by 400ft was being blown south towards the M5. |
A spokesman said the chemical reacted badly in contact with water and advised people to avoid baths or showers until it had dispersed. | A spokesman said the chemical reacted badly in contact with water and advised people to avoid baths or showers until it had dispersed. |
Residents living near the fire in Langley, near Oldbury, have been asked to keep doors and windows shut. | Residents living near the fire in Langley, near Oldbury, have been asked to keep doors and windows shut. |
Eye irritation | Eye irritation |
Fire crews were called to reports of a blaze at Rhodia Consumer Specialities in Trinity Street, Langley, at 1230 GMT. | Fire crews were called to reports of a blaze at Rhodia Consumer Specialities in Trinity Street, Langley, at 1230 GMT. |
The cause of the incident is not known, but there have been no reports of injuries. | The cause of the incident is not known, but there have been no reports of injuries. |
The cloud is described as white in appearance with phosphorous causing eye irritation, sneezing, sore throats and shortness of breath. | The cloud is described as white in appearance with phosphorous causing eye irritation, sneezing, sore throats and shortness of breath. |
Police have closed off the road from Birchley Island to Causeway Green Road. | Police have closed off the road from Birchley Island to Causeway Green Road. |
